Sunderland 2 - Portsmouth 0

The Stadium Of Light

13th January 2008 13:30

Attendance: 37369

Sunderland 2 Portsmouth 0

Sunderland collected their first win of the year thanks to a Kieran Richardson double. Pompey struggled to handle the Sunderland duo of Richardson and Jones who were immense throughout the game.

Portsmouth started the game the brighter of the two sides with Benjani and Hredarsson coming close.

Richardson then got his first goal of the game when Jones burst past Campbell and cut back a wonderful low cross that Richardson dispatched to the right of James.

Richardson got Sunderland`s second minutes later when he burst in to the area to pick up a loose ball after Murphy struggled to control the ball. Richardson first touch was great to lose Hreidarsson and his placed shot to James left was even better.

Sunderland started the second half where they left off with Richardson nearly getting his third but his curled shot was just a bit high.

Benjani then should have done better when he failed to find Nugent after he found himself one on one with Gordon, Evans with the vital clearance.

Richardson was again unlucky not to score when left foot shot from the edge of the area hit the bar.

Sunderland then managed to run the clock down for the remaining 5 minutes or so.

Sunderland deserved the win and could have won by more.
